Group 24 (F): Dimensions: 10.25 x 6.8 x 8.9 inches Typical Use: This size is popular for cars, light trucks, and RVs. It provides a good balance of power and compactness. Power Capacity: Typically has a 70–80 Ah rating and a CCA range of around 600–750, making it suitable for moderate climates.

Moreover, owing to mini-modules, Ample has developed the most compact swap station in the market, the size of one parking lot. Interestingly, a few months ago, battery manufacturer CATL entered the swapping market with a form factor called Choco Pack sited in between full-size batteries and Ample's minis.
